Mikel Arteta reveals Arsenal's 24 man squad for Europa League 2022-23 season

Share This
Mikel Arteta has annouced Arsenal's squad for their Europa League campaign for the 2022-23 season. 

If you recall that the Gunners clinched the ticket after finishing fifth in the Premier League last term. 

Arsenal suffered their first defeat against Manchester United at Old Trafford stadium over the weekend. 

Prior to the loss, Mikel Arteta side had recorded five victories on the row in the league as they sit on top of the Premier League table. 

But goals from Antony Santos and  Marcus Rashford brace condemned the north London side to their first league defeat. 

Although, Bukayo Saka, who turned 21 years old scored the only goal of the game for the Gunners. 

Arsenal will turn their attention to the Europa League opening group game on Thursday evening. 

The Gunners travel to Switzerland to face Swiss Super League side, FC Zurich in their opening game. 

Arsenal's Europa League Full List:

Goalkeepers: Aaron Ramsdale, Matthew Charles, James Hillson

Defenders: Ben White, Gabriel, William Saliba, Rob Holding, Cedric, Takehiro Tomiyasu, Oleksandr Zinchenko

Midfielders: Tierney, Thomas Partey, Odegaard, Fabio Vieira, Lokonga, Elneny, Xhaka, Matthew Smith

Forwards: Jesus, Smith Rowe, Martinelli, Nketiah, Nelson, Alencar

Mikel Arteta will be hoping to better his team's last outing in Europa League after they were knocked out by eventual winners Villarreal in 2021.

If you recall that the Gunners didn't qualify for European club competition in 2021-2022 season after finishing in eight position.
